Python基础教程:从累加到累乘的计算方法详解
创始人
2024-12-25 00:31:50
0 次浏览
0 评论
python求累加的计算过程
累加过程涉及从1到n的加法。代码如下所示:sum=0foriinrange(n+1):sum=sum+iprint(sum)。
最终的结果是从1到n的累加和。
如何在程序中实现十个数相加并输出结果?
您可以使用循环和加法来加10并打印结果。下面是一个Python代码示例:#定义一个列表来存储10个数字number=[1,2,3,4,5,6,7,8,9,10]#对累积结果求和DefineVariablestosave=0#扫描列表中的每个数字并累加到一个总变量中。
fornumberinnumbers:sum+=number#输出相加结果。
print("累计结果为:",sum)如果复制并运行此代码,输出将是:结果是:55
Python求累加、累乘
Python中的求和与积:基础知识和应用
1.累加
在Python中,求1到100的和是一个基本运算。
两种方法的实现概述:
方法二(while循环):</```python#初始化变量总计,i=0,startwhilei
累积乘法</
求1乘10的乘积,也有两种方法:而while:
方法一(for循环):</```pythondefmultiply_range(start,stop,multivalue=1):#注意初始值不能为0foriinrange(start,stop):multivalue*=ireturnmultivalueresult3=multiply_range(1,11)result3````方法2(循环while):</```python#初始化乘积multivalue=1i=startwhilei
要求e值,我们可以将累加乘法和循环结合起来,首先封装累加乘法函数,然后用它来实现e的计算:
Python代码:</```pythonimportmathdeffactorial(n):ifn==0orn==1:return1else:returnn*阶乘(n-1)defe_approximation(n_terms=100):e=1foriinrange(1,n_terms+1):e*=(1+1/i)returneapproximated_e=e_approximation()approximated_e```通过上面的例子,我们看到for循环在已知范围内效率更高,而while循环更加灵活。
了解这两种循环的特点,将有助于我们在实际问题中选择最合适的实现方法。
相关文章
彻底卸载SQL Server 2008:...
2024-12-16 03:20:46SQL2000数据库备份压缩技巧:优化空...
2024-12-15 22:07:13SQL CASE WHEN 语句详解及L...
2024-12-18 23:20:56Linux Redis缓存清理与启动指南
2024-12-24 00:32:13MySQL CMD启动故障排查与解决指南
2024-12-25 20:40:48一招轻松掌握:如何快速查看MySQL版本...
2024-12-24 09:39:56高效导入SQL文件:MySQL两种常用方...
2024-12-24 04:48:13MySQL数据库查看表操作指南:快速掌握...
2024-12-15 21:49:17MySQL主从复制详解:原理、应用与优化...
2024-12-18 02:14:48如何在CMD命令窗口快速打开MySQL服...
2024-12-25 00:05:54最新文章
25
2024-12
25
2024-12
25
2024-12
25
2024-12
25
2024-12
25
2024-12
25
2024-12
25
2024-12
25
2024-12
25
2024-12
热门文章
1
SQL2000数据库备份压缩技巧:优化空...
怎么将SQL2000中的较大的备份数据库压缩变小更改数据库属性-选项-恢复模型很...
2
高效掌握:CMD命令轻松启动、关闭及登录...
如何用cmd命令快速启动和关闭mysql数据库服务开发中经常使用MySQL数据库...
3
SQL字符串处理技巧:单引号使用与转义标...
SQL语句中,字符串类型的值均使用什么符号标明?单引号如果字符串内有单引号,请小...
4
Windows环境下Redis安装指南与...
redis安装windowsredis基本简介与安装安装Redis首先需要获取安...
5
深度解析:Redis性能优势与局限性,助...
redis有哪些优缺点?Redis的全称是RemoteDictionary.Se...
6
深入解析:MySQL数据库的特性与应用
mysql是什么MySQL是一个关系数据库管理系统。MySQL是一个开源关系数据...
7
MySQL日志类型全解析:二进制、错误与...
MySQL的三种日志类型详解mysql三种日志类型MySQL日志的三种类型,详解...
8
Redis基础入门:详解Key-Valu...
如何读取redis中的key值中的结果首先需要连接redis客户端redis-c...
9
C语言编程必备:99乘法表经典代码解析
c语言必背代码有哪些?1.输出表达式/*9*9。总共9行9列,其中i控制行,j控...
10
MySQL数据列不显示问题解决方案指南
如何在MySQL中快速解决数据表中某列数据不显示的问题mysql不显示某列数据如...